    As a Senior Estimator, you will supervise a team of Estimators in an effort to price and bid multiple projects. You will work under an experienced professional that will provide you with opportunity to learn the department's standard operating procedures and build strong relationships with the Preconstruction team. You will have a heavy hand in the coordination and supervision of other Estimators and will price/bid projects that shape your community. Additionally, Gilbane offers employees multi-dimensional training opportunities through several resources for those that are early in their career. Our award-winning Learning & Development department, Gilbane University, offers a variety of in-person and webinar-based trainings to help you excel in your career.
    Responsibilities
    • Read plans and specifications and understand the requirements of the RFP focusing on electrical systems (high and medium voltage), switchgear, fixtures and devices, temporary power requirements, power distribution, Telecomm, Electronic safety and security, and other related specification sections.
    • Analyze, quantify, and provides cost estimates for the electrical scope of work. Inclusive of Gilbane's General Requirements.
    • Develops accurate labor crews, crew productivity and provides input for project schedule.
    • Advise designers, in design-build projects, on solution with the lowest initial cost to meet the RFP.
    • Write effective RFI's.
    • Creates and coordinates comprehensive bid packages.
    • Identify and engage with electrical subcontractors throughout the bidding process.
    • Create and distribute the electrical bid scope of work checklist.
    • Collect, analyze, and compare competitive subcontract and supplier bids.
    • Develops and recommends appropriate risk register values for this scope of work.
    • Tracks and reports on current material and labor prices, including escalation.
    • Tracks and reports on current material and equipment to identity long-lead items.

    EXPERIENCE/EDUCATION
    • Bachelor's degree in engineering or construction management field and/or office experience equivalency.
    • 7-10+ years relevant experience
    • Lump Sum Bidding.
    • Experience in Federal construction programs and markets is desired but not required.

    K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S & ABILITIES
    • Extensive knowledge of AccuBid, On-Screen Take-off, and similar software for take-offs and estimate pricing for electrical systems construction.
    • Supportive computer skills for varied formats such as basic Windows applications plus pdf's, TEAMS, Zoom, etc.
    • Ability to support the design and layout development of electrical and low voltage systems for design-build pursuits.
    • Ability to present estimating deliverables to management and explain advantages in utilizing one contractor over another, scope gaps, cost swings, etc.
    • Ability to conceptually estimate projects with limited information.
    • Ability to estimate multiple facility types such as hospitals, hangars, office structures, specialized mission structures, base improvements, renovations, and additions.
    • Ability to maintain healthy working relationships with industry partners (Owners, designers, subcontractors, etc.) for the development of estimating deliverables.
